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
754259215 830 219436
520742618 34781
520742618 34781
65760336 0929 787437272 11620 22738841317
All about undefined
Interested in learning more?
520742618 34781
65760336 0929 787437272 11620 22738841317
See more
203 55152
7125707 18 261208
See more
045423497 71978927 84232
508788 78925 11867875341
See more